50/50: The Minimum Amount of Dry Food
In a dog’s 50/50 diet, meat and dry food are mixed. The idea is to get proteins and fats from the meat, and use the dry food as a source of trace elements and vitamins.

Calcium is the most common mineral in the body and a very important electrolyte for muscle and nerve function, while also being the main building block of the skeleton. In puppy nutrition, it is perhaps the most studied component, as researchers have sought to understand its role in bone development and growth disorders.
